            Jimmy------

            Parts from the old GM AC Division usually have different GM part numbers depending on whether destined for SERVICE or PRODUCTION. The AC part number (e.g. CV769C and usually embossed on the part) is the same and the SERVICE and PRODUCTION parts are virtually always identical but the GM "long numbers" are almost always different. So, in the vast majority of AC-supplied components one cannot use the part numbers in the AIM to determine the correct SERVICE part number.

              Doug------


              Keep in mind that the CV 769C PCV valve has been available from GM for nearly 50 years, right up to the present day. All are equally functional. However, there have been nuances of configuration differences over the years and, especially, since AC ceased to be a GM manufacturing division and part manufacture was outsourced. So, if you are interested in exact original configuration you need to obtain an NOS CV769C that was manufactured 50 or so years ago. That can get difficult and expensive.
